Sunbury Court is in Shoeburyness, Southend-On-Sea and in Southend-On-Sea district. SS3 8TR is located in the Shoeburyness elect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Rochford and Southend East. This postcode has been in use since 1991-01-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Sunbury Court was 109.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 31.1% higher than the Shoeburyness average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Sunbury Court has the 12th highest crime rate of 37 local areas in Shoeburyness and the 160th highest crime rate of 530 local areas in Southend-on-Sea .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 87.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-7.4%.
